Trade credit allows approved business customers to purchase on account rather than paying at standard checkout. Once a credit account is approved, purchases may be invoiced and payment collected within the agreed terms. Approved Power-Hub trade credit accounts operate on standard 30-day payment terms from invoice date unless different terms are confirmed in writing.
Credit accounts are available only to approved trade customers and are separate from standard retail checkout. Credit limits, payment periods, account status and purchasing permissions are controlled by Power-Hub and may be reviewed, reduced, suspended, increased or withdrawn at any time.
Each approved trade credit customer may be assigned a credit limit. If an order would take the account over its credit limit, we may require payment by card, bank transfer or another method before processing. Credit limits may be reviewed on request but increases are not guaranteed.
Invoices issued under a trade credit facility must be paid within the agreed payment period stated on the invoice or account agreement. Unless otherwise confirmed in writing, standard approved payment terms are 30 days from invoice date.
If a business customer fails to pay on time, exceeds its credit limit, becomes insolvent, provides inaccurate information, disputes payment without valid reason, fails credit checks, or otherwise breaches account terms, Power-Hub may suspend further orders, place the account on hold, require payment in advance, withdraw credit facilities, cancel unfulfilled orders, charge interest and recovery costs where legally permitted, refer the debt to a collection agency or solicitor, and demand immediate payment of all outstanding sums.

If you are a UK consumer buying online, you may have the right to cancel most online purchases within 14 days of receiving the goods without giving a reason, subject to legal exceptions. You must notify us within 14 days of receiving the goods that you wish to cancel or return the order. Once you have notified us, you then have a further 14 days to send the item back or arrange collection where applicable.
Returned goods must be unused, complete, securely packed, returned with accessories, manuals, components, labels and packaging where applicable, and in resaleable condition unless the item is faulty, damaged, incorrect or non-compliant.
Unopened and unused products will usually be eligible for a full refund subject to inspection. Opened but unused products may still be returned within the return period, but we may apply a reasonable deduction where appropriate and permitted, particularly where packaging is damaged, product value has been reduced, or handling exceeds what is necessary to inspect the item.
